Security analysis of security inspection mode of air cargo classification and grade
After the goods pass the security inspection,four types of security inspection results are generated:true alarm,true clear,false alarm,and false clear.This article takes the probability of false clear as an indicator to measure the security of traditional security inspection mode and classified and graded security inspection mode.Using a visual search plus decision model,the process of security inspection personnel judging images is analyzed,and the probability of false alarms and false clear in the security inspection system is obtained.Based on the queuing theory formula,the time required for goods to complete security inspection is calculated.A non-linear programming model is established for traditional security inspection mode and classified and graded security inspection mode,with the actual time of the security inspector judging images as the decision variable,minimizing the probability of security inspection false clear as the goal,and using security inspection false alarm and average security inspection time of goods as constraints.An example analysis is conducted on the optimization model,and the results show that when m is 0.1,using the classified and graded security inspection mode can significantly improve the security of the security inspection system while ensuring the speed of goods passing through.Finally,sensitivity analysis is conducted,and the results show that compared with the traditional security inspection mode,the classified and graded security inspection mode reduces the probability of false clear and greatly improves system security when the proportion of high-risk goods m is in the(0,0.45)range,and the optimal value of m is 0.12.Compared with the traditional security inspection mode,the classified and graded security inspection mode can significantly improve system security in three situations,namely,when the airport has a large cargo volume,the goods urgently need security inspection,or the airport can accept a higher probability of false alarm.
